The remains of John Cutler, an old man who had lived tn and about Silver City for more than twenty years, were found on the Snake river plains, about six miles from Murphy, badly torn and mutilated by animals. He had probably wandered out on the desert and died. Lee Spangler, a prosperous grocer of York, Pa. who styles himself.“The Lest Prophet,” and who for twelve „Years has been predicting the end of the world in 1908, announces that within twelve months all Europe will be flghting, and the United States, too. There are encouraging reports from Albany county, Wyoming, on some mining properties. The Strong mine has struck a vein of ore in the shaft four feet eight inches wide and in the drift they have not yet determined the width. The mine is fourteen miles east of Laramie.
